Изменения документа Для_разработчиков
Редактировал(а) Михаил Галич 26.11.2024, 12:16
<
>
отредактировано Михаил Галич
на 14.12.2023, 14:14
на 14.12.2023, 14:14
отредактировано Георгий Тарасюк
на 13.12.2023, 14:19
на 13.12.2023, 14:19
Изменить комментарий:
allow edit права для XWiki.XWikiGuest
Комментарий
-
Свойства страницы (2 изменено, 0 добавлено, 0 удалено)
-
Объекты (2 изменено, 0 добавлено, 0 удалено)
Подробности
- Свойства страницы
-
- Автор документа
-
... ... @@ -1,1 +1,1 @@ 1 -XWiki. galich1 +XWiki.force - Содержимое
-
... ... @@ -275,17 +275,6 @@ 275 275 bundlesid: false // уберёт все пакеты услуг с первой страницы 276 276 {{/code}} 277 277 278 -==== bundleslessonstariffsid ==== 279 - 280 -Тип данных:##// Array<number>//## 281 - 282 -По умолчанию:##// []//## 283 - 284 -(% class="box warningmessage" %) 285 -((( 286 -Описание отсутствует 287 -))) 288 - 289 289 ==== groupid ==== 290 290 291 291 Тип данных:##// number//## ... ... @@ -329,69 +329,30 @@ 329 329 }) 330 330 {{/code}} 331 331 332 ----- 333 - 334 334 === Отображение === 335 335 336 -==== cartmaxitems====323 +==== forcetab ==== 337 337 338 -Тип данных:##// number//##325 +Тип данных:##// string//## 339 339 340 -По умолчанию:##// 6//##327 +По умолчанию:##// ''//## 341 341 342 -(% class="wikigeneratedid" %) 343 -Ограничивает максимальное кол-во товаров в корзине. ##Минимальное значение 1. Максимальное значение 60.## 329 +Переключение на необходимую вкладку виджета («покупка услуг» или «пополнение услуг») при загрузке. По умолчанию открывается вкладка «покупка услуг». forcetab: 'rewrite' принудительно откроет «пополнение услуг». Обычно используется в комбинации с параметром ##onlytab## 344 344 345 -==== cartminitems====331 +==== onlytab ==== 346 346 347 -Тип данных:##// number//##333 +Тип данных:##// string //##//|## Array<string>##// 348 348 349 -По умолчанию:##// 1//## 350 - 351 -Ограничивает минимальное кол-во товаров в корзине. ##Минимальное значение 1. Максимальное значение 60.## 352 - 353 -==== categories ==== 354 - 355 -Тип данных:##// Array<string>//## 356 - 357 357 По умолчанию:##// []//## 358 358 359 -(% class="box warningmessage" %) 360 -((( 361 -Описание отсутствует 362 -))) 337 +Скрытие других вкладок виджета («покупка услуг» или «пополнение услуг») при загрузке. Обычно используется в комбинации с параметром forcetab 363 363 364 -==== clubsiteid ==== 339 +{{code language="javascript"}} 340 +onlytab: 'service' // покажет только вкладку «покупка услуг». 341 +onlytab: 'rewrite' // покажет только вкладку «пополнение услуг». 342 +onlytab: ['service', 'rewrite'] // покажет только вкладки «покупка услуг» и «пополнение услуг»; 343 +{{/code}} 365 365 366 -Тип данных:##// number//## 367 - 368 -По умолчанию:##// 0//## 369 - 370 -(% class="box warningmessage" %) 371 -((( 372 -Описание отсутствует 373 -))) 374 - 375 -==== coachid ==== 376 - 377 -Тип данных:##// number//## 378 - 379 -По умолчанию:##// undefined//## 380 - 381 -(% class="box warningmessage" %) 382 -((( 383 -Описание отсутствует 384 -))) 385 - 386 -==== disablemultipleseances ==== 387 - 388 -Тип данных:##// boolean//## 389 - 390 -По умолчанию:##// false//## 391 - 392 -Параметр предотвращает добавление в корзину тарифов с различными сеансами. 393 -Таким образом как только в корзине появится хоть один товар с сеансом "10:00 - 11:30", товары, у которых есть сеанс например "13:00 - 14:30" будет невозможно добавить в корзину. Товары без сеансов не будут затронуты. 394 - 395 395 ==== forcemedia ==== 396 396 397 397 Тип данных:##// string//## ... ... @@ -406,86 +406,38 @@ 406 406 forcemedia: 'E0012345678900' 407 407 {{/code}} 408 408 409 -==== forceseanceid====359 +==== nopromo ==== 410 410 411 -Тип данных:##// number//##361 +Тип данных:##// boolean//## 412 412 413 -По умолчанию без указания идентификатора не учитывается.363 +По умолчанию:##// false//## 414 414 415 - Заставит виджет выбрать мероприятиеареныпоидентификаторуплатформы ине позволятьвернуться кэтапу выборадругих мероприятий.365 +Убирает вывод промокода на странице подтверждения заказа. 416 416 417 -==== forcesectorid====367 +==== terminal ==== 418 418 419 -Тип данных:##// number//## 420 - 421 -По умолчанию без указания идентификатора не учитывается. 422 - 423 -Заставит виджет выбрать сектор мероприятия по id и не позволять вернуться к этапу выбора других секторов. 424 - 425 -==== forcetab ==== 426 - 427 -Тип данных:##// string//## 428 - 429 -По умолчанию:##// ''//## 430 - 431 -Переключение на необходимую вкладку виджета («покупка услуг» или «пополнение услуг») при загрузке. По умолчанию открывается вкладка «покупка услуг». forcetab: 'rewrite' принудительно откроет «пополнение услуг». Обычно используется в комбинации с параметром ##onlytab## 432 - 433 -==== grouplessonsskillstariffs ==== 434 - 435 -Тип данных:##// Array<number> //##//|## object##// 436 - 437 -По умолчанию:##// {}//## 438 - 439 -(% class="box warningmessage" %) 440 -((( 441 -Описание отсутствует 442 -))) 443 - 444 -==== grouplessonstariffsid ==== 445 - 446 -Тип данных:##// Array<number>//## 447 - 448 -По умолчанию:##// []//## 449 - 450 -(% class="box warningmessage" %) 451 -((( 452 -Описание отсутствует 453 -))) 454 - 455 - 456 - 457 -==== ismobile ==== 458 - 459 459 Тип данных:##// boolean//## 460 460 461 461 По умолчанию:##// false//## 462 462 463 -(% class="box warningmessage" %) 464 -((( 465 -Описание отсутствует 466 -))) 373 +Включение режима «терминал» для работы виджета. При этом режиме убирается возможность отослать заказ на SMS, а сам заказ распечатывается на принтере. 467 467 468 -==== lessonslocation====375 +==== cartmaxitems ==== 469 469 470 470 Тип данных:##// number//## 471 471 472 -По умолчанию:##// undefined//##379 +По умолчанию:##// 6//## 473 473 474 -(% class="box warningmessage" %) 475 -((( 476 -Описание отсутствует 477 -))) 381 +(% class="wikigeneratedid" %) 382 +Ограничивает максимальное кол-во товаров в корзине. ##Минимальное значение 1. Максимальное значение 60.## 478 478 479 -==== lessonstariffsid====384 +==== cartminitems ==== 480 480 481 -Тип данных:##// Array<number>//##386 +Тип данных:##// number//## 482 482 483 -По умолчанию:##// []//##388 +По умолчанию:##// 1//## 484 484 485 -(% class="box warningmessage" %) 486 -((( 487 -Описание отсутствует 488 -))) 390 +Ограничивает минимальное кол-во товаров в корзине. ##Минимальное значение 1. Максимальное значение 60.## 489 489 490 490 ==== locale ==== 491 491 ... ... @@ -495,143 +495,81 @@ 495 495 496 496 Параметр локализации. Позволяет переключать между языками виджета, например 'ru' - русский язык, 'en' - английский язык. 497 497 498 -==== marketbillid====400 +==== ordercomment ==== 499 499 500 -Тип данных:##// number//##402 +Тип данных:##// string//## 501 501 502 -По умолчанию:##// undefined//##404 +По умолчанию:##// ''//## 503 503 504 -(% class="box warningmessage" %) 505 -((( 506 -Описание отсутствует 507 -))) 406 +Опциональный комментарий к заказу. Максимальная длинна комментария 50 символов. 508 508 509 -==== marketemployeeid====408 +==== disablemultipleseances ==== 510 510 511 -Тип данных:##// number//## 512 - 513 -По умолчанию:##// undefined//## 514 - 515 -(% class="box warningmessage" %) 516 -((( 517 -Описание отсутствует 518 -))) 519 - 520 -==== minimap ==== 521 - 522 522 Тип данных:##// boolean//## 523 523 524 -По умолчанию:##// true//##412 +По умолчанию:##// false//## 525 525 526 -Отображать миникарту. 414 +Параметр предотвращает добавление в корзину тарифов с различными сеансами. 415 +Таким образом как только в корзине появится хоть один товар с сеансом "10:00 - 11:30", товары, у которых есть сеанс например "13:00 - 14:30" будет невозможно добавить в корзину. Товары без сеансов не будут затронуты. 527 527 528 -==== minimapaspect ====417 +==== tariffsseancesfilter ==== 529 529 530 -Тип данных:##// number//## 531 - 532 -По умолчанию:##// 0.2//## 533 - 534 -Размер миникарты относительной полного размера карты, а не контейнера, в которой она находится. 535 - 536 -==== multidayslessonsskillstarif(% style="display:none" %) (%%)fs ==== 537 - 538 -Тип данных:##// Array<number> //##//|## object##// 539 - 540 -По умолчанию:##// []//## 541 - 542 -Производит фильтрацию тарифов для многодневных занятий. Принимает массив идентификаторов. Параметр дополняет фильтрацию по параметру grouplessonsskillstariffs. 543 - 544 -==== nocategories ==== 545 - 546 546 Тип данных:##// boolean//## 547 547 548 548 По умолчанию:##// false//## 549 549 550 -(% class="box warningmessage" %) 551 -((( 552 -Описание отсутствует 553 -))) 423 +[[image:https://info.moipass.ru/images/tariffsseancesfilter.png||alt="Example"]] 554 554 425 +Включить отображение фильтра тарифов по сеансам. 555 555 427 +==== resetcart ==== 556 556 557 -==== nocoach ==== 558 - 559 559 Тип данных:##// boolean//## 560 560 561 561 По умолчанию:##// false//## 562 562 563 -(% class="box warningmessage" %) 564 -((( 565 -Описание отсутствует 566 -))) 433 +Автоматически очищать содержимое корзины. 567 567 435 +==== minimap ==== 568 568 437 +Тип данных:##// boolean//## 569 569 570 - ====nolocations ====439 +По умолчанию:##// true//## 571 571 572 - Тип данных:##// boolean//##441 +Отображать миникарту. 573 573 574 - Поумолчанию:##// false//##443 +==== minimapaspect ==== 575 575 576 -(% class="box warningmessage" %) 577 -((( 578 -Описание отсутствует 579 -))) 445 +Тип данных:##// number//## 580 580 581 - ====nopromo ====447 +По умолчанию:##// 0.2//## 582 582 583 - Типданных:##// boolean//##449 +Размер миникарты относительной полного размера карты, а не контейнера, в которой она находится. 584 584 585 - Поумолчанию:##//false//##451 +==== forceseanceid ==== 586 586 587 - Убираетвыводпромокодаа странице подтверждения заказа.453 +Тип данных:##// number//## 588 588 589 - ====noskills====455 +По умолчанию без указания идентификатора не учитывается. 590 590 591 - Тип данных:##// boolean//##457 +Заставит виджет выбрать мероприятие арены по идентификатору платформы и не позволять вернуться к этапу выбора других мероприятий. 592 592 593 - Поумолчанию:##//false//##459 +==== forcesectorid ==== 594 594 595 -(% class="box warningmessage" %) 596 -((( 597 -Описание отсутствует 598 -))) 461 +Тип данных:##// number//## 599 599 463 +По умолчанию без указания идентификатора не учитывается. 600 600 465 +Заставит виджет выбрать сектор мероприятия по id и не позволять вернуться к этапу выбора других секторов. 601 601 602 -==== notariffs====467 +==== requiredloyalty: true ##//boolean//## ==== 603 603 604 604 Тип данных:##// boolean//## 605 605 606 606 По умолчанию:##// false//## 607 607 608 -(% class="box warningmessage" %) 609 -((( 610 -Описание отсутствует 611 -))) 473 +Включает обязательную регистриацию клиента в программе настроенной на объектке. 612 612 613 -==== onlytab ==== 614 - 615 -Тип данных:##// string //##//|## Array<string>##// 616 - 617 -По умолчанию:##// []//## 618 - 619 -Скрытие других вкладок виджета («покупка услуг» или «пополнение услуг») при загрузке. Обычно используется в комбинации с параметром forcetab 620 - 621 -{{code language="javascript"}} 622 -onlytab: 'service' // покажет только вкладку «покупка услуг». 623 -onlytab: 'rewrite' // покажет только вкладку «пополнение услуг». 624 -onlytab: ['service', 'rewrite'] // покажет только вкладки «покупка услуг» и «пополнение услуг»; 625 -{{/code}} 626 - 627 -==== ordercomment ==== 628 - 629 -Тип данных:##// string//## 630 - 631 -По умолчанию:##// ''//## 632 - 633 -Опциональный комментарий к заказу. Максимальная длинна комментария 50 символов. 634 - 635 635 ==== personallessonsskillstariffs ==== 636 636 637 637 Тип данных:##// Array<number> //##//|## object##// ... ... @@ -640,45 +640,15 @@ 640 640 641 641 Производит фильтрацию тарифов для индивидуальных занятий. Принимает массив идентификаторов. 642 642 643 -==== placeid ====483 +==== multidayslessonsskillstarif(% style="display:none" %) (%%)fs ==== 644 644 645 -Тип данных:##// number//## 485 +Тип данных:##// Array<number> //##//|## object##// 646 646 647 -По умолчанию:##// undefined//## 648 - 649 -(% class="box warningmessage" %) 650 -((( 651 -Описание отсутствует 652 -))) 653 - 654 -==== requiredloyalty ==== 655 - 656 -Тип данных:##// boolean//## 657 - 658 -По умолчанию:##// false//## 659 - 660 -Включает обязательную регистриацию клиента в программе настроенной на объектке. 661 - 662 -==== resetcart ==== 663 - 664 -Тип данных:##// boolean//## 665 - 666 -По умолчанию:##// false//## 667 - 668 -Автоматически очищать содержимое корзины. 669 - 670 -==== rewritetariffsid ==== 671 - 672 -Тип данных:##// Array<number>//## 673 - 674 674 По умолчанию:##// []//## 675 675 676 -(% class="box warningmessage" %) 677 -((( 678 -Описание отсутствует 679 -))) 489 +Производит фильтрацию тарифов для многодневных занятий. Принимает массив идентификаторов. Параметр дополняет фильтрацию по параметру grouplessonsskillstariffs. 680 680 681 -==== saletermstype ==== 491 +==== saletermstype: 'checkbox' ##//string//## ==== 682 682 683 683 Тип данных:##// string//## 684 684 ... ... @@ -691,48 +691,3 @@ 691 691 saletermstype: 'dialog' // покажет всплывающее окно с правилами, которые нужно принять. 692 692 saletermstype: 'default' // принятие правил не требуется. 693 693 {{/code}} 694 - 695 -==== shownoticketsseances ==== 696 - 697 -Тип данных:##// boolean//## 698 - 699 -По умолчанию:##// false//## 700 - 701 -(% class="box warningmessage" %) 702 -((( 703 -Описание отсутствует 704 -))) 705 - 706 -==== showoverseances ==== 707 - 708 -Тип данных:##// boolean//## 709 - 710 -По умолчанию:##// false//## 711 - 712 -(% class="box warningmessage" %) 713 -((( 714 -Описание отсутствует 715 -))) 716 - 717 - 718 - 719 -==== skills ==== 720 - 721 -Тип данных:##// Array<number>//## 722 - 723 -По умолчанию:##// []//## 724 - 725 -(% class="box warningmessage" %) 726 -((( 727 -Описание отсутствует 728 -))) 729 - 730 -==== tariffsseancesfilter ==== 731 - 732 -Тип данных:##// boolean//## 733 - 734 -По умолчанию:##// false//## 735 - 736 -[[image:https://info.moipass.ru/images/tariffsseancesfilter.png||alt="Example"]] 737 - 738 -Включить отображение фильтра тарифов по сеансам.
- XWiki.XWikiRights[0]
-
- levels
-
... ... @@ -1,1 +1,1 @@ 1 -view 1 +view,edit
- XWiki.XWikiRights[1]
-
- levels
-
... ... @@ -1,1 +1,1 @@ 1 -delete,script ,edit,comment1 +delete,script